Well we fished it today and there is plenty of ice, 12-13 1/2 inches through most of the pond, we ended up with 2 browns and 5 brookies.  The browns were 1.5-2lbs and the brookies were 1.5-2.5 lbs, all in all a pretty good day.

We used shiners, small to mediums.  We started out at the boat launch in the morning we got the 2 browns there and one brookie. Around 12 myself and one of my buddies picked up and moved across the pond to the shallow water around one of the little streams that flow into the pond while the others stayed at the boat launch.  We made the right move as we got 4 nice brookies there and missed one other while the others that stayed at the launch got nothing in the afternoon.  We did use salmon eggs in the holes when we moved to the shallow end, we did have a couple holes get cleaned out but i'm pretty sure they were brookies as our traps that went off in the holes that got cleaned out all had brookies on them.
